Online learning, emerging as a game-changer in the ever-evolving landscape of education, offers unprecedented flexibility and accessibility. The popularity of online classes among Bachelor of Computer Applications (BCA) students is on the rise. This article presents compelling reasons supporting the wise and advantageous choice to opt for BCA online classes.
Flexibility and Convenience:
Consider online BCA classes primarily for their unparalleled flexibility: a key reason to opt for these courses. Traditional on-campus classes often impose fixed schedules and location constraints; this challenges students to balance academic pursuits with other responsibilities. Conversely, online classes offer an enticing advantage – they permit students not only to set their own study schedule but also provide them the freedom to learn at their preferred pace from the comfort of home. Especially for individuals with work commitments or personal obligations, this flexibility demonstrates its invaluable nature.
Access to a Global Network:
Online BCA classes, with their digital nature, transcend geographical boundaries: they enable global student connections to peers and professors. This network fosters a myriad of perspectives–a diversity that enhances collaborative learning experiences. Students engage not only in discussions; rather–they share ideas and collaborate on projects with individuals from varying cultures and backgrounds—an experience that enriches their understanding of computer applications on an unprecedented global scale.
Enhanced Technological Proficiency:
Being part of a tech-centric discipline, BCA students can derive significant benefits from the virtual environment of online classes. Their technological proficiency improves as they engage with digital learning platforms, collaboration tools and online resources. They develop essential digital skills by navigating virtual classrooms, participating in online discussions and submitting assignments electronically; this preparation equips them for the demands of the modern workplace.
Cost-Efficiency:
Participating in traditional on-campus classes often necessitates a range of expenses: commuting costs, fees for accommodations, and sundry additional charges. Online BCA classes circumvent many of these financial encumbrances—thus rendering education more cost-effective. Students manage to economize on transportation and lodging; concurrently, they continue receiving an education distinguished by its high quality. Digital resources often enhance cost savings by reducing the necessity for textbooks; moreover, their availability significantly contributes to this advantage.
Personalized Learning Experience:
Students in online BCA classes can personalize their learning experience to align with their unique needs and preferences. They typically have 24/7 access to course materials, lectures, and resources; this availability enables them not only to reinforce concepts but also to engage in supplementary readings—advancing at a pace that suits them best. Moreover, adaptive learning technologies frequently integrated into these platforms personalize the educational journey: they cater specifically for individual strengths and weaknesses – thus guaranteeing an educationally effective yet bespoke experience.
Diverse Career Opportunities:
An online BCA program completion: opens the gateway to a multitude of career opportunities. A wide array of roles presents themselves–all within the perpetually expanding domain of information technology. The positions for which online BCA graduates are particularly well-suited include:
Web Developer: Leveraging their knowledge of JavaScript, HTML, and PHP at a graduate level; graduates can create–as well as maintain–websites. Their focus ensures functionality: they make certain the sites are visually appealing while also optimizing for performance.
Software/Application Developer: Software developers thrive in the development of desktop or mobile applications; they play a crucial role in creating, implementing, and maintaining software solutions. They utilize various programming languages and tools for this purpose.
Software Tester: Testers actively ensure software quality and reliability: they design and implement methods for testing the software; and identify flaws or issues–a crucial step in maintaining product excellence, which is their overarching responsibility.
Network Administrator: Network administrators manage organizational networks, including LAN, MAN, WANs, intranets and network segments; they hold a critical role in ensuring the security–as well as performance–of these systems. Their responsibilities extend to overseeing communication systems for smooth network operations: an essential function within any organization.
Web Designer: Web designers focus on the design and maintenance of visually appealing, user-friendly websites; they integrate text–graphics, sounds–and even videos: all to elevate the overall user experience.
Computer Programmer: Computer programmers, responsible for the writing, altering and testing of code; work intimately with software developers. Their task is to translate design specifications into precise instructions – a crucial step in guaranteeing optimal software performance.
System Analyst: System analysts actively bridge the gap between an organization’s IT and managerial departments; they design new computer systems, address technical issues with precision–and align technology solutions strategically to meet business objectives.
System Engineer: System engineers manage the engineering, business, and managerial aspects of a system; their primary focus lies in ensuring effective operations. They troubleshoot issues that arise within the system – optimizing its performance to guarantee smooth functionality.
Conclusion
The world’s embrace of digital transformation continually illuminates the advantages of online education. Opting for online classes presents BCA students with a plethora of benefits: flexibility and cost-efficiency; an expansive global network — not to mention enhanced technological proficiency.
Students who choose the best online BCA course in India not only establish a sturdy foundation in computer applications, but also develop the skills and knowledge necessary for excelling in various technology-related professions. This enhances their employability and promotes success within the constantly evolving field of information technology.